* chore: track the graphify knowledge graph and the bug-hunt ledger

Both were local-only, so a clone — including a cloud session, which sees
only tracked files — started with no graph and no findings history.

graphify-out/: the top-level built graph is now tracked so a fresh clone can
query it without a rebuild. Subdirectories stay ignored: cache/ is a
per-machine AST cache, and graphify parks the previous graph in a dated
YYYY-MM-DD/ backup on every rebuild (18 MB of stale duplicate, a local
rollback aid rather than shared state).

.gitattributes marks the tree -text: the repo-wide `* text=auto eol=lf` rule
would otherwise rewrite line endings inside .graphify_labels.json.sig, which
signs the labels byte-for-byte, and invalidate the signature on checkout.
graph.json/graph.html also get -diff, and the tree is linguist-generated so
it stays out of language stats and collapses in review.

.superpowers/: findings-ledger.json, its FINDINGS.md render and
render-ledger.mjs are tracked so contributors can add findings by PR. Hunt
transcripts, .bak snapshots and debris patches remain per-session scratch.

Tradeoff accepted deliberately: the post-commit rebuild hook rewrites
graph.json, so each refresh writes a fresh ~18 MB blob into history. Refresh
it in its own commit rather than folding it into an unrelated diff.

* chore(graphify): share the PreToolUse graph-first nudge hooks

The two hook-guard hooks lived in the gitignored settings.local.json with an
absolute C:/Users path, so no other clone got them. Portable form: bare
`graphify` off PATH, and `|| exit 0` so a contributor without graphify
installed is never blocked.

OwnCord

Self-hosted chat platform (alpha). Server/ is a Go 1.26 REST + WebSocket server over SQLite with LiveKit voice/video; Client/tauri-client/ is a Tauri v2 desktop app (TypeScript frontend, thin Rust backend). Per-component detail lives in Server/CLAUDE.md and Client/tauri-client/CLAUDE.md; the protocol and schema are documented in docs/protocol.md, docs/schema.md, and docs/architecture/README.md.

Generated code — never hand-edit

CI fails on drift, and the next generator run silently discards your edit.

Knowledge graph (graphify)

graphify-out/ holds a committed knowledge graph of this repo — god nodes, communities, cross-file edges. It is checked in so a fresh clone can query it without a rebuild.

  • For codebase questions, run graphify query "<question>" before grepping. graphify path "<A>" "<B>" for relationships, graphify explain "<concept>" for one concept. These return a scoped subgraph — far smaller than GRAPH_REPORT.md or raw grep output.
  • Read graphify-out/GRAPH_REPORT.md only for broad architecture review.
  • After changing code, graphify update . refreshes it (AST-only, no API cost). graphify hook install wires that to a post-commit hook — .git/hooks/ is not tracked, so each clone installs it once.
  • graphify-out/cache/ is a per-machine AST cache and stays ignored.

The graph is generated: never hand-edit it, and refresh it in its own commit rather than folding an 18 MB blob into an unrelated diff.

Bug-hunt ledger

.superpowers/findings-ledger.json is the shared ledger of hunt findings — open a PR against it to add one. FINDINGS.md is rendered from it:

node .superpowers/render-ledger.mjs           # rewrite FINDINGS.md
node .superpowers/render-ledger.mjs --check   # validate the ledger only

Statuses: open, fixed, declined, refuted, duplicate, blocked. Never edit FINDINGS.md by hand — edit the ledger and re-render. Everything else under .superpowers/ is per-session scratch and stays local.

Gotchas

  • Verify with the ci-check skill, not with an ad-hoc go build && go test. CI compiles four Go build-tag variants and runs a deadlock-detection pass; the default build proves nothing about the tagged ones.
  • The client unit suite is green and must stay green. Never make a failing test pass by weakening its assertions.
  • Security issues go through GitHub Security Advisories, never public issues (docs/security.md). This repo is public — unfixed defects do not belong in commits, issues, or PR descriptions.
  • Branch from main, PR to main, squash merge, conventional commit subjects.
